Double Spring
Double Spring is a spring in DeKalb County, Alabama. Double Spring is situated nearby to the locality Powells Crossroads, as well as near the area Sand Mountain.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Powell and Rainsville.

Powell is a town in DeKalb County, Alabama, United States. At the 2020 census, the population was 901. Powell is located atop Sand Mountain. Originally incorporated as Powell's Crossroads in the 1960s, it had shortened its name to Powell by the 1990 U.S. Census. Powell is situated 2 miles west of Double Spring.

Rainsville is a city in DeKalb County, Alabama, United States. As of the 2020 census, Rainsville had a population of 5,505. Rainsville is located on top of Sand Mountain, a southern extension of the Cumberland Plateau. Rainsville is situated 2½ miles south of Double Spring.

Sylvania is a town in DeKalb County, Alabama, United States. Established in 1836 and incorporated in October 1967, As of the 2020 census, Sylvania had a population of 1,790. Sylvania is located atop Sand Mountain. The first post office was built in 1977. Sylvania is situated 3½ miles northeast of Double Spring.
